New paper alert MPI-AB is on Bluesky @mpi-animalbehav.bsky.social MSU Mara Hyena Project: After inheriting social status from mom, hyenas decline in rank over their lives📉—not by being overtaken, but because of the combination of demographic turnover + rank inheritance (1/6) doi.org/10.1098/rstb.2…

For #hyenas, inherited power is no laughing matter: new study shows that after inheriting social status from mom, every member of a hyena clan, except the top-ranking queen👑, faces a lifetime of decreasing social status mpg.de/20515992/0626-… Eli Strauss MPI-AB is on Bluesky @mpi-animalbehav.bsky.social
